      "content": "\n\n# Domain Expert Assessment: APOE4-Driven Cholesterol Dysregulation in Oligodendrocytes\n\n## 1. Hypotheses with Highest Translational Potential\n\n### Tier 1: **Cholesterol Efflux Enhancement via ABCA1/ABCG1 Activation**\n\nThis approach has the strongest translational alignment with existing druggable targets. Rather than inhibiting SREBP2 (which risks disrupting compensatory biosynthetic pathways), enhancing downstream cholesterol efflux channels the system toward restoration of myelin lipid homeostasis. Critically, this avoids the liver toxicity that derailed first-generation LXR agonists by targeting oligodendrocyte-selective pathways.\n\n### Tier 2: **ApoE4-Structural Stabilization or Isoform-Specific Chaperone Therapy**\n\nThis addresses the root cause if ApoE4 destabilization is confirmed as the primary upstream event. Structural stabilization would prevent proteasomal degradation, restore physiological ApoE levels, and re-establish normal LXRβ feedback. The challenge is developing CNS-penetrant small molecules with isoform specificity.\n\n### Tier 3: **SREBP2-Attenuated Function in Oligodendrocytes (via Cleavage Inhibitors or SCAP Modulators)**\n\nDespite the Skeptic's valid concerns, SREBP2 remains an attractive target if temporal dynamics can be established. A therapeutic window may exist where modest SREBP2 reduction corrects dysregulation without impairing baseline myelination.\n\n---\n\n## 2.
